French Herb Tomato Soup with Quinoa

This comforting soup with quinoa is finished with fresh tarragon and chives, for a simple and satisfying lunch any time of the year.

French Herb Tomato Soup with Quinoa

Cooking time
PREP TIME 10 mins
Cooking time
COOK TIME 15 mins
Servings
SERVES 2-4
Ready in
TOTAL TIME 25 mins

Ingredients

  • 1 bag Success® Tri-Color Quinoa
  • 4 tsp butter
  • 2 small carrots, diced
  • 2 shallots, diced
  • 4 tomatoes, chopped
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 2 tbsp finely chopped fresh chives
  • 1 tbsp finely chopped fresh tarragon

Instructions

  • Cozy up to a bowl of something warm tonight! Made with a few simple ingredients, such as sautéed shallots, carrots and tomatoes, blended with broth and topped with Success® Tri-Color Quinoa and herbs, this soup is satisfying, flavorful and easy to prepare.

    Step 1

  • Prepare quinoa according to package directions.

    Step 2

  • Meanwhile, melt butter in a saucepan set over medium heat. Cook carrots and shallots for 3 to 5 minutes, or until slightly softened. Stir in tomatoes and bro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to medium-low. Cook for 10 to 12 minutes, or until vegetables are very tender.

    Step 3

  • Stir in quinoa and return soup to a simmer. Cook for 1 minute, or until heated through. Sprinkle with chives and tarragon before serving.

    Recipe Tip

    For a smoother soup, puree it using a hand blender before adding the quinoa.

Homemade Soup

Making your own soup at home can be quite simple and this satisfying recipe is just that! In just 3 steps and 25 minutes, you’ll have turned fresh ingredients into a warm pot of soup that’s ready to serve!

To save time while cooking, have all of your ingredients peeled, sliced, measured and ready to go before you start. Then, all you’ll need to do is to focus on what comes next in your recipe.

What really takes this soup to the next level are the French herbs, chives and tarragon, that are sprinkled over the top. However, basil can also be substituted in for the tarragon, if that’s what you have on hand.
